Summary

Croconaw is a Water-type Pokémon introduced in Generation II.

Type: Water

Abilities:

  • Torrent: Powers up Water-type moves when the Pokémon’s HP is low.
  • Sheer Force (Hidden Ability): Increases the power of moves with secondary effects by 30%, but removes those effects.

Physical Characteristics:

  • Croconaw is a bipedal, crocodilian Pokémon.
  • It has blue skin with a yellow, V-shaped pattern on its chest and a yellow lower jaw.
  • Its body is covered in blue scales, and it has red spiky structures on its head and tail.
  • It has a robust build, strong jaw, and sharp, triangular teeth visible even when its mouth is closed.

Behavior and Habitat:

  • Croconaw is typically found in freshwater areas like lakes and rivers.
  • It is known for its powerful bite and tenacity, often using its strong jaw to latch onto prey and not let go.
  • It is a relatively aggressive Pokémon, known for its protective nature and territorial instincts.

In Battle:

  • Croconaw is a balanced fighter with decent defensive and offensive capabilities.
  • It often uses moves such as Aqua Tail, Ice Fang, and Crunch to exploit its physical strengths.
  • Strong against Fire, Ground, and Rock types due to its Water type.
  • Vulnerable to Electric and Grass type moves.

Evolution:

  • Evolves from Totodile starting at level 18.
  • Evolves into Feraligatr starting at level 30.

Interesting Facts:

  • Croconaw's design is inspired by crocodiles and alligators, evident in its appearance and behavior.
  • The red spikes on its back and tail are reminiscent of primitive reptiles, giving it a prehistoric look.
  • Its jaw strength is a defining characteristic, and it is said to never let go once it bites something.
  • Its name combines “crocodile” and “gnaw,” reflecting both its species and its powerful bite.
